To apply to the Wine MBA programme, you need to have a Bachelor’s degree or equivalent plus a minimum working experience of 5 years (preferably in the wine sector).
Candidates with no experience in the wine sector should have an immediate, detailed project to enter the sector.
TOEFL test is required for non English speakers.

Individual interviews may be led by telephone after the reception of the application form.
Acceptance will be communicated to the candidate within 10 days after reception of the application form. Two copies of the contractual documents will then be sent by post. One is to be signed and returned by the candidate. Final acceptance is submitted to payment of the registration fee.
20 places are offered each year in the Wine MBA program.
The cost of the programme is 25,500 Euros for the whole school year, including tuition and lunches during every session; additional costs are accomodation (a list of hotels is provided by the program in Bordeaux, Adelaide, London and Davis) and travels.
The tuition fees may be paid in several instalments over the whole school year. We require 5,500 Euros at registration (to be paid in 2009); then, 12,000 Euros may be paid in 2010 in 3 instalments; the remaining 8,000 Euros may be paid in 2 instalments in 2011.
